Analysis
The most recent figure for merchandise imports (current us$), per unit of gdp in Colombia is 0.1541 current US$ per US$ of GDP, measured in 2025.
That represents a change of up 1.1% on the previous year and down 16.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, merchandise imports (current us$), per unit of gdp in Colombia peaked at 0.224 current US$ per US$ of GDP in 2022 and was at its lowest, 0.0788 current US$ per US$ of GDP, in 1965.
Colombia ranks 182nd of 203 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 66 years of available data.

How this figure is calculated
Merchandise imports (current US$) divided by GDP (current US$),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
Merchandise imports (current US$) ÷ GDP (current US$)
Computed from
- Merchandise imports World Trade Organization (WTO)
- GDP Country official statistics, National Statistical Organizations and/or Central Banks
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
